#21bc1c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#21bc1c is composed of 12.9% red, 73.7%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.1%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 118.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#21bc1c color hex could be obtained by blending #42ff38 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#21bc1c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#21bc1c has RGB values of R:33, G:188,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 2210844.

Hex triplet 21bc1c #21bc1c
RGB Decimal 33, 188, 28 rgb(33,188,28)
RGB Percent 12.9, 73.7, 11 rgb(12.9%,73.7%,11%)
CMYK 82, 0, 85, 26
HSL 118.1°, 74.1, 42.4 hsl(118.1,74.1%,42.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 118.1°, 85.1, 73.7
Web Safe 33cc33 #33cc33
CIE-LAB 66.803, -65.487, 62.161
XYZ 18.819, 36.372, 7.127
xyY 0.302, 0.584, 36.372
CIE-LCH 66.803, 90.291, 136.492
CIE-LUV 66.803, -60.212, 78.582
Hunter-Lab 60.309, -49.841, 35.209
Binary 00100001, 10111100, 00011100

Shades and Tints of #21bc1c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#effcee is the lightest one.

Tones of #21bc1c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677167 is the less saturated color, while #0ad503 is the most saturated one.
